Struct x86_64::registers::model_specific::CetFlags   
source · pub struct CetFlags(/* private fields */);Expand description
Flags stored in IA32_U_CET and IA32_S_CET (Table-2-2 in Intel SDM Volume 4). The Intel SDM-equivalent names are described in parentheses.
Implementations§
source§impl CetFlags
 
impl CetFlags
sourcepub const SS_WRITE_ENABLE: Self = _
 
pub const SS_WRITE_ENABLE: Self = _
Enable WRSS{D,Q}W instructions (WR_SHTK_EN)
sourcepub const IBT_ENABLE: Self = _
 
pub const IBT_ENABLE: Self = _
Enable indirect branch tracking (ENDBR_EN)
sourcepub const IBT_LEGACY_ENABLE: Self = _
 
pub const IBT_LEGACY_ENABLE: Self = _
Enable legacy treatment for indirect branch tracking (LEG_IW_EN)
sourcepub const IBT_NO_TRACK_ENABLE: Self = _
 
pub const IBT_NO_TRACK_ENABLE: Self = _
Enable no-track opcode prefix for indirect branch tracking (NO_TRACK_EN)
sourcepub const IBT_LEGACY_SUPPRESS_ENABLE: Self = _
 
pub const IBT_LEGACY_SUPPRESS_ENABLE: Self = _
Disable suppression of CET on legacy compatibility (SUPPRESS_DIS)
sourcepub const IBT_SUPPRESS_ENABLE: Self = _
 
pub const IBT_SUPPRESS_ENABLE: Self = _
Enable suppression of indirect branch tracking (SUPPRESS)
sourcepub const IBT_TRACKED: Self = _
 
pub const IBT_TRACKED: Self = _
Is IBT waiting for a branch to return? (read-only, TRACKER)
